diff options
Diffstat (limited to 'scene/gui/file_dialog.cpp')
-rw-r--r-- | scene/gui/file_dialog.cpp |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/scene/gui/file_dialog.cpp b/scene/gui/file_dialog.cpp index a0cf5f5970..79d563c072 100644 --- a/scene/gui/file_dialog.cpp +++ b/scene/gui/file_dialog.cpp @@ -70,9 +70,9 @@ void FileDialog::_update_theme_item_cache() { theme_cache.folder = get_theme_icon(SNAME("folder")); theme_cache.file = get_theme_icon(SNAME("file")); - theme_cache.folder_icon_modulate = get_theme_color(SNAME("folder_icon_modulate")); - theme_cache.file_icon_modulate = get_theme_color(SNAME("file_icon_modulate")); - theme_cache.files_disabled = get_theme_color(SNAME("files_disabled")); + theme_cache.folder_icon_color = get_theme_color(SNAME("folder_icon_color")); + theme_cache.file_icon_color = get_theme_color(SNAME("file_icon_color")); + theme_cache.file_disabled_color = get_theme_color(SNAME("file_disabled_color")); // TODO: Define own colors? theme_cache.icon_normal_color = get_theme_color(SNAME("font_color"), SNAME("Button")); @@ -552,7 +552,7 @@ void FileDialog::update_file_list() { TreeItem *ti = tree->create_item(root); ti->set_text(0, dir_name); ti->set_icon(0, theme_cache.folder); - ti->set_icon_modulate(0, theme_cache.folder_icon_modulate); + ti->set_icon_modulate(0, theme_cache.folder_icon_color); Dictionary d; d["name"] = dir_name; @@ -613,10 +613,10 @@ void FileDialog::update_file_list() { } else { ti->set_icon(0, theme_cache.file); } - ti->set_icon_modulate(0, theme_cache.file_icon_modulate); + ti->set_icon_modulate(0, theme_cache.file_icon_color); if (mode == FILE_MODE_OPEN_DIR) { - ti->set_custom_color(0, theme_cache.files_disabled); + ti->set_custom_color(0, theme_cache.file_disabled_color); ti->set_selectable(0, false); } Dictionary d; |